Serving Sheffield's literary community for over 25 years, we have a monthly Book Group, regular author events, and oodles of brilliant Children's events.
Our shop is home to a passionate bookselling team who will help you choose the perfect read. We have an expert range of local (and not so local) Travel Guides, a diverse Fiction section, and the most exciting Children's Discovery Zone this side of the moon. Not to mention our enormous range of Games, Gifts, Cards, Stationery and Toys. (And cakes! Don't forget the cakes!).
Use our Click & Collect service and we'll have your book waiting for you when you arrive. Buy it at the online price, chat to us about your favourite reads, then have a cup of tea, sit back and relax.
This is your bookshop, so please tell us what you think, and enjoy a world of words at Waterstones.
